WREXHAM AFC will be holding a collection for Wrexham Foodbank on Saturday (April 30), ahead of the match against Southend United.

The club is asking all supporters who are able to ‘bring a tin’ with them - with collections being taken at the ticket collection windows in the Macron Stand, on the Mold Road.

READ MORE: Wrexham foodbank use higher now than before covid pandemic

Food items only are being collected, and not cash donations as the club also has the match-day charity bucket collection on the day – with Saturday’s collection in aid of JDRF, the Type 1 Diabetes charity.

Wrexham Foodbank are in particular need of the following items, and all donations will be gratefully received and passed on:

1 litre UHT milk

1 litre orange/apple juice

200ml orange/apple juice

Tuna tins

Rice pudding

Tomato pasta sauce jars

Toilet paper
